Is SFO Terminal 1 domestic or international?

SFO Terminal 1, known as Harvey Milk Terminal 1, hosts inbound and outbound domestic flights within the US and is home of domestic boarding areas B (B6-B27) and C (C2-C11).

Do Terminal 1 and 2 connect at SFO?

Post-security connectors are available between: International Terminal “A” Gates (Gates A1 through A15) and Harvey Milk Terminal 1 (Gates B1 through B27) Terminal 2 (Gates C2 through D18), Terminal 3 (Gates E1 through F22), and the International Terminal “G” Gates (Gates G1 through G14)

Can you walk from Terminal 1 to International Terminal at SFO?

Harvey Milk Terminal 1 Passengers can walk within the secure area to connect to a flight at the International Terminal. To connect to any other terminals, this would require walking outside of the secure area or riding the AirTrain.

Is there a Global Entry office at the International Terminal?

Inside the International Terminal is a Global Entry Office at the Pre-Security and Arrivals Level, as well as a Medical Clinic at the Pre-Security and Departures/Ticketing Level.
